Output 43fcfcf36f861a3b28e7e3f83a1e5c1ceea94c6560a9dafdbc35cf987f44b370:0

value
4331335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ee52ce4158cfd7518f18b0c87a48b380b1f0a48 OP_EQUAL
address
38tBAtY5xNQjTJ9arsDv5nP6UZbecDMQxt
transaction
43fcfcf36f861a3b28e7e3f83a1e5c1ceea94c6560a9dafdbc35cf987f44b370
spent
true